Output d1558b499ee80b1f4f441db3b59f1e7b2b93dca14c282cefb268efe70695e256:2

value
10674518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a26b36f64f2bbf65d5e3305028fc427ae3bfb891 OP_EQUAL
address
3GVoq2aGk8gbgivQcyZ7wV2MH9szqAKYkA
transaction
d1558b499ee80b1f4f441db3b59f1e7b2b93dca14c282cefb268efe70695e256
spent
true